用重组人胰岛素原类似物免疫制备抗胰岛素单克隆抗体

     【摘要】 目的 制备抗胰岛素单克隆抗体(mAb)。方法 用重组人胰岛素原类似物免疫BALB/c小鼠制备免疫脾细胞,运用淋巴细胞杂交瘤技术将其与小鼠骨髓瘤细胞SP2/0融合。结果 建立了7株分泌抗胰岛素mAb的杂交瘤细胞系,命名为A、B、C、D、E、F和G;7株mAb的Ig亚类分别为IgM、IgM、IgM、IgG2b、IgG1、IgG1和IgG1;在夹心ELISA试验中,7株mAb均能与人、牛和猪胰岛素发生特异性免疫反应;在免疫印迹试验中,7株mAb均能与重组人胰岛素原类似物结合呈现一条蛋白印迹带。结论 7株mAb对人、牛和猪胰岛素均具有免疫反应性,可用于人和动物胰岛素的测定和纯化。

    Development of monoclonal antibodies against insulin by immunization with recombinant human proinsulin analog

    LIU Yu, WANG Yong-shan, SUN Mao-hua, et al.

    Center for Disease Control and Prevention of Nanjing Command, Military Medical Institute of Nanjing Command, Nanjing 210002, China

    【Abstract】 Objective To prepare monoclonal antibody (mAb) against insulinMethods Spleen cells from BALB/c mice immunized with recombinant human proinsulin analog were fused with SP2/0 myeloma cells by using hybridoma techniques.Results Seven hybridomas secreting mAb against insulin were established and designated A, B, C, D, E, F and G. The subclass of the seven mAb was IgM, IgM, IgM, IgG2b, IgG1, IgG1 and IgG1 respectively. The seven mAb could specifically react with insulin derived from human, cattle or pig in sandwich ELISA. The specific reaction of each mAb with recombinant human proinsulin analog was confermed by immunoblotting assay, only one stained protein band appeared on the transferred film.Conclusion The seven mAb are immunological specific to insulin derived from human, cattle or swine, and are available to the detection and purification of insulin. ......
